Cost Overview

Most families pay around $22,518 annually after aid, though costs vary dramatically by income. Families earning under $30,000 pay just $16,792 per year, while those making over $110,000 face nearly $28,700. Over four years, expect total costs between $67,000 and $115,000 depending on your family's financial situation.

Only 35% of students receive financial aid, and just 17% get institutional grants averaging $8,619. Graduates typically carry $25,000 in debt, translating to $265 monthly payments. With median starting salaries around $54,468, that debt payment represents about 6% of gross income. The 68% loan repayment rate suggests some graduates struggle with these obligations.

Lower-income families get the best deal here, paying roughly half what wealthy families do. This campus particularly benefits students seeking an affordable Penn State experience before transferring to University Park.
